Output 04c96529b0531846d51a4be7c16181bdd6ae64318e985fbddc55d94f45ecde5e:0

value
201408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c800854ea878d0ad161456a3a77871f87daef1fb OP_EQUAL
address
3KvXh6E2Npex4dadprMAyHJsWbzkDkjzeC
transaction
04c96529b0531846d51a4be7c16181bdd6ae64318e985fbddc55d94f45ecde5e
spent
true